Glazed Vanilla Donuts
These Glazed Vanilla Donuts are soft, fluffy, and bursting with vanilla flavor, topped with a smooth, sweet glaze and colorful sprinkles. Baked instead of fried, they’re easy to make at home and perfect for breakfast, brunch, or dessert.
Prep Time 15 minutes mins
Cook Time 15 minutes mins
Total Time 30 minutes mins
Donuts:
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 2 large eggs at room temperature
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ter melted
- 1 cup vanilla-flavored creamer or whole milk with a touch of extra vanilla extract
- 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 2 teaspoons ba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
Glaze:
- 3 cups powdered sugar
- 2 –3 tablespoons vanilla-flavored creamer or milk
- Sprinkles for decoration
Preheat oven to 325°F (160°C). Lightly grease two 6-cavity donut pans.
In a mixing bowl, whisk together sugar, eggs, melted butter, vanilla creamer, and vanilla extract until smooth.
In a separate bowl, combine flour, baking powder, and salt. Make a well in the center.
Pour wet ingredients into the dry mixture and stir until just combined.
Spoon batter into a piping bag or ziplock bag, snip the corner, and pipe into prepared donut pans.
Bake for 14–15 minutes, until donuts are golden and spring back when touched.
Remove from oven and let cool slightly before glazing.
For the glaze, whisk powdered sugar with just enough vanilla creamer to create a thick, smooth glaze.
Dip cooled donuts into glaze or spread glaze on top with a spoon.
Decorate with sprinkles and allow glaze to set before serving.

Don’t overmix the batter; it keeps the donuts light and fluffy.
-
Use a piping bag for even filling of the pans and a neater finish.
-
Add food coloring to the glaze for themed events or holidays.
-
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 2 days.
